Transaction cfe82a522ef263487ef910b65c9ae212d68f67e220f552aab242316d3f2b4138
2 Input
2 Outputs
- cfe82a522ef263487ef910b65c9ae212d68f67e220f552aab242316d3f2b4138:0
- cfe82a522ef263487ef910b65c9ae212d68f67e220f552aab242316d3f2b4138:1
value 778250
address 17MjEfvMKkuqAvEAvp6akjVr3x8zftV1Vm
value 8661120
address 38121LRACBupEwHjGNavXkaTkhdHDgQgPi